ARLINGTON -- An 18-year-old man has been arrested in connection with the death of a 21-year-old man last month.

Police are charging Tomas Alonso Herrera-Meza with murder in the shooting death of Trinidad Lopez Jr. that occurred on Sunday Sept. 21 at the Sutter Creek Apartments in east Arlington, police said.

Family members have said they were told that Lopez was shot inadvertently when someone fired into the air after a fight had broken out at the complex.

Police said there are indications that Meza is a gang member.

Meza also is being held at the Arlington Jail on an immigration hold and on a probation violation warrant issued by The Texas Youth Commission.

No bail has been set.
